Why do fence posts in Millville Town Center need footings below 36 inches?
The 36-inch frost line depth is a structural mandate. Footings must extend below this point to resist frost heave, which lifts and cracks posts. The IRC requires this depth for post stability. Shallow footings in this neighborhood will fail.

How does Millville's 105 MPH V-ult wind speed affect fence design?
The 105 MPH V-ult rating is the ultimate design wind speed. Engineering to ASCE 7-22 standards dictates closer post spacing, deeper footings, and heavy-duty brackets. This design resists peak storm season gusts without structural failure.
